W124 Sedan (4-door)


Technical data

This E300 MT (190 hp) engine was fitted in the W124 Sedan (4-door), which was produced by Mercedes-Benz from 1985 to 1993. Power & fuel consumption

City fuel consumption per 100 km12.1litre
Highway fuel consumption per 100 km6.5litre
Mixed fuel consumption per 100 km8.3litre
Fuel tank capacity70litre
Cruising rangefrom 580 to 1 080km
Fuel92 RON
Top speed230km/h
Acceleration (0–100 km/h)7.9second

Engine

Displacement2962cm3
Engine power190bhp
RPM at max powerto 5 600RPM
Maximum torque260Nm
RPM at max torque4250RPM
Engine typeGasoline
Cylinder layoutInline
Injection typeMulti-point injection
Number of cylinders6
Valves per cylinder2
Bore88.5mm
Stroke80.25mm

Gearbox & drivetrain

GearboxManual
Number of gears5
Drive wheelsRear-wheel drive
Turning circle11.2m

Body

Seats5
Length4740mm
Width1740mm
Height1446mm
Wheelbase2800mm
Front track1497mm
Rear track1488mm
Kerb weight1340kg
Gross weight1860kg
Displacement520kg
Min. boot capacity521litre
Max. boot capacity521litre
Front/rear axle load890/870kg
Permitted road-train weight3360kg
Body typeSedan

Suspension & brakes

Front suspensionIndependent, Stabilizer bar
Rear suspensionIndependent, Multi wishbone, Stabilizer bar
Front brakesDisc
Rear brakesDisc
